Abstract
At leading order, there are three inelastic scattering processes beginning with a quantum kink and a fundamental meson. Meson multiplication, in which the final state is a kink and two mesons, was treated recently. In this note we treat the other two, (anti)-Stokes scattering, in which the kink’s shape mode is (de-)excited and the final state contains one meson. In the case of a general scalar kink, we find analytic formulas for the forward and backward scattering amplitudes and probabilities as functions of the momentum of the incident meson. The general results are then specialized to the kink of the ϕ4 double-well model.
